WORLD INLINE CUP

The WORLD INLINE CUP (WIC) is since 2000 the highest international marathon series for inline speed skaters. The world´s best skaters take part in the world's most demanding and biggest marathon races in Europe and Asia and meet fitness skaters from all over the globe. The overall winners will receive prize money after the season. Since 2014 the organizer of the WORLD INLINE CUP is IGUANA Deutschland GmbH

PRELIMINARY WORLD INLINE CUP CALENDAR 2022 IS ONLINE

RACES IN ITALY, FRANCE, PORTUGAL, GERMANY & USA CONFIRMED

ADDITIONAL RACES REMAIN TBA

Berlin, 17th January 2022. Despite the still dynamic pandemic situation the WORLD INLINE CUP organisation can publish today a preliminary calendar for the WORLD INLINE CUP season 2022. Currently six races in five countries are confirmed.
"We are happy to publish a solid calendar with six races in five countries and two continents. Some organisers and partners have to plan cautiously due to the still tense pandemic situation in their regions. In this respect, further races are to be expected in case of a withdrawal of the virus and positive developments, about which we will inform promptly", says Volker Schlichting, Executive Director of the WORLD INLINE CUP.

We are looking forward to a joint season with a new old spirit and a lot of optimism.
